New book: “No Root for You”

Over the years, Gordon L. Johnson has realized the information available for non-experts concerning network auditing is rather scarce. His new book, “No Root for You”, seeks to eliminate the confusion too commonly associated with network auditing, leaving the typical user more educated and protected.

An illustrated step-by-step tutorial guide, “No Root for You” explains not only how one would go about auditing and securing their network, but exactly why each exploit works, so users can fully grasp and apply the concepts covered.

Written in layman’s terms, the book stresses the importance of security and why such awareness is crucial in regards to computing.
